Notable Early Footballers
When we're talking about notable early footballers, several names stand out. One of the earliest stars was Fritz Walter, the captain of the 1954 World Cup-winning team. Walter's leadership and skill were instrumental in Germany's surprising victory. His ability to rally his team, coupled with his tactical understanding of the game, made him a legend. Then there's Sepp Herberger, the coach who masterminded the 1954 triumph, instilling a sense of tactical discipline and strategic thinking that became a hallmark of German football. Key Players of the Golden Era
Some of the players who defined the Golden Era include Franz Beckenbauer, a defender of exceptional skill and vision. Known as 'Der Kaiser' (The Emperor), Beckenbauer was a masterful player and a brilliant leader on the pitch. His elegant style, strategic intelligence, and ability to read the game were unparalleled. Then there's Gerd Müller, one of the most prolific goalscorers in the history of the game. Müller's predatory instincts in front of goal and his remarkable ability to score in crucial moments earned him the nickname 'Der Bomber'. His goals were instrumental in Germany's success. Current Stars and Their Impact
Among the current stars, Manuel Neuer stands out as one of the best goalkeepers in the world. Neuer's shot-stopping ability, his commanding presence in the box, and his ability to initiate attacks from the back make him a vital asset to both club and country. He redefined the role of a goalkeeper, becoming a sweeper-keeper and adding a new dimension to the position. Then we have Toni Kroos, a midfielder with exceptional passing skills and game intelligence. Kroos's ability to dictate the tempo of a match, his precision in passing, and his vision have made him a key player for both club and country.
